What is Ledger Live?

Ledger Live is an all-in-one platform that allows users to manage their cryptocurrency portfolios, perform transactions, and check the market in real-time. Available for both desktop and mobile, Ledger Live is a trusted app by millions for securely managing assets stored on Ledger hardware wallets, such as the Ledger Nano S and Ledger Nano X. The app itself supports more than 1,800 coins and tokens, ensuring versatility for users.

Importance of Ledger Live Login

The login process in Ledger Live ensures a secure gateway between your Ledger hardware wallet and the platform. This step is crucial as it prevents unauthorized access to your assets. The login method typically requires verifying your identity with the physical Ledger device, adding an extra layer of security that is much stronger than traditional password protection.

How External Linking Improves Security

One of the biggest advantages of Ledger Live login with external linking is that it never exposes your private keys to third-party platforms. When you log into a service via Ledger Live, the transaction or verification is signed within the secure environment of your hardware wallet, ensuring that your private keys stay protected.

This system of external linking is particularly beneficial for decentralized finance (DeFi) users. Many DeFi platforms operate without centralized control, so protecting your assets is crucial. Ledger Live’s external linking feature allows you to use these platforms without risking your private keys to security breaches.
